A higher education institution is looking for an HR Generalist to support daily HR operations at its New York campus. This role involves serving as a primary contact for employee inquiries, managing onboarding and offboarding processes, and coordinating leave administration. The ideal candidate should possess a Bachelor’s degree and 1-2 years of relevant HR experience. Strong communication skills, attention to detail, and experience with HR systems are essential. This position offers a salary range of approximately $50,096 to $62,620 annually.
